The Visits by Browser metric shows the number of visits to a website categorized by the type of browser used by the visitors. It helps in understanding the popularity of different browsers among visitors and can aid in optimizing website performance for specific browsers.

Visits by Device Model metric shows the number of visits to a website categorized by the type of device used, such as smartphones, tablets, desktops or laptops. It helps website owners understand how their visitors access their site and tailor their content accordingly.
The Unique Visitors by City metric shows the number of distinct visitors who accessed a website from a particular city.
The Returning Visits metric counts the number of times visitors return to a website after their first visit.
Bounce rate is the percentage of website visits where the visitor only views one page and then leaves without interacting further with the site.
The Actions metric in Matomo measures user interactions on a website, such as clicks, downloads, and video plays, providing insight into user behavior.
Pageviews is a metric that measures the total number of times a webpage has been viewed, including multiple views by the same user.
The Outlinks metric in Matomo tracks the number of clicks on links that redirect visitors to external websites from your own website.
The Avg. Page Load time metric measures the average amount of time it takes for a web page to fully load in a user's browser. This metric can help identify performance issues that may be impacting user experience.
